在個人網(wǎng)站服務(wù)器租用中,數(shù)據(jù)備份和恢復(fù)是保障網(wǎng)站正常運(yùn)行的重要手段。通過定期對網(wǎng)站數(shù)據(jù)進(jìn)行備份,可以在遇到意外情況時快速恢復(fù)到之前的狀態(tài),從而減少因數(shù)據(jù)丟失而造成的損失。例如,當(dāng)出現(xiàn)硬盤故障、誤操作或受到黑客攻擊等特殊情況時,我們就可以利用備份的數(shù)據(jù)來還原整個網(wǎng)站。數(shù)據(jù)備份也是遵守相關(guān)法律法規(guī)的要求。對于一些涉及用戶隱私信息的網(wǎng)站來說,做好數(shù)據(jù)備份工作可以避免因?yàn)閿?shù)據(jù)泄露而導(dǎo)致的法律風(fēng)險。
1. 選擇合適的備份工具和存儲位置。我們可以使用第三方提供的專業(yè)備份工具,如阿里云OSS、騰訊云COS等,也可以自行編寫腳本實(shí)現(xiàn)自動化備份。在選擇存儲位置時,要考慮到數(shù)據(jù)的安全性和可訪問性,建議將備份文件存放在異地服務(wù)器上,以防止本地發(fā)生災(zāi)難*件影響到備份文件。
2. 確定需要備份的內(nèi)容。我們需要備份數(shù)據(jù)庫中的所有表結(jié)構(gòu)和記錄、網(wǎng)站根目錄下的所有文件(包括HTML頁面、CSS樣式表、J*aScript腳本、圖片等靜態(tài)資源)、配置文件(如PHP.ini、Nginx.conf等),以及服務(wù)器環(huán)境的相關(guān)參數(shù)(如Apache或Nginx的版本號、安裝路徑等)。
3. 制定合理的備份計(jì)劃。根據(jù)業(yè)務(wù)需求和個人習(xí)慣,可以選擇每天凌晨定時執(zhí)行一次全量備份,或者每隔一段時間只備份新增加的數(shù)據(jù)。為了節(jié)省空間,還可以采用壓縮算法對備份文件進(jìn)行處理。
4. 定期檢查備份文件的完整性和可用性??梢酝ㄟ^模擬恢復(fù)過程來驗(yàn)證備份文件是否能夠正常使用,一旦發(fā)現(xiàn)問題就要及時調(diào)整備份策略。
1. 準(zhǔn)備好最新的備份文件。從備份存儲位置下載最新的一份備份文件,并將其上傳至目標(biāo)服務(wù)器。
2. 恢復(fù)數(shù)據(jù)庫。如果使用的是MySQL數(shù)據(jù)庫,那么可以先登錄到MySQL命令行界面,然后使用source命令加載.sql格式的備份文件;如果是其他類型的數(shù)據(jù)庫,則需要按照官方文檔提供的方法進(jìn)行操作。
3. 恢復(fù)網(wǎng)站文件。將備份文件解壓后復(fù)制到網(wǎng)站根目錄下覆蓋原有文件即可。
4. 調(diào)整服務(wù)器配置。由于不同服務(wù)器之間的環(huán)境可能存在差異,因此在完成上述步驟之后還需要重新設(shè)置域名解析、修改配置文件中的IP地址等內(nèi)容,確保網(wǎng)站能夠正常訪問。
5. 測試網(wǎng)站功能。最后一步就是全面測試各個頁面的功能是否正常,包括但不限于前臺展示效果、后臺管理界面、用戶注冊登錄流程等。
# 成都網(wǎng)站建設(shè)要嗨收費(fèi)
# 淄博網(wǎng)站定制建設(shè)費(fèi)用
# 廣東網(wǎng)站公司建設(shè)網(wǎng)站
# 金華網(wǎng)站建設(shè)在線
# 泰安網(wǎng)站建設(shè)與維護(hù)試卷
# 河北品牌網(wǎng)站建設(shè)服務(wù)商
# 長春網(wǎng)站建設(shè)知識分享
# 青島網(wǎng)站建設(shè)ppt
# 網(wǎng)站建設(shè)王振鋒
# 東光網(wǎng)城網(wǎng)站建設(shè)
# 掇刀區(qū)公司網(wǎng)站建設(shè)價格
# 教育網(wǎng)站建設(shè)收費(fèi)
# 丁莊網(wǎng)站建設(shè)
# 湛江網(wǎng)站建設(shè)方法
# 磁力搜索網(wǎng)站建設(shè)主題
# 四惠商城網(wǎng)站建設(shè)
# 品牌網(wǎng)站建設(shè)業(yè)務(wù)
# 晉江專業(yè)網(wǎng)站建設(shè)
# 嶗山區(qū)自適應(yīng)網(wǎng)站建設(shè)
# 天水專業(yè)網(wǎng)站建設(shè)